French journalist notes 'unprecedented' papal criticism of Irish bishops

March 22, 2010

Jean-Marie Guenois, religion correspondent for Le Figaro, notes that while the immediate impact of Pope Benedict's letter to the Irish Church is limited, the most noteworthy aspect of the papal statement on that country's sex-abuse crisis is the Pontiff's candid criticism of the way the Irish hierarchy had handled the issue.
